What Does HVAC Service Mean for a Norcross Homeowner?

HVAC service here in Norcross covers everything needed to keep your heating and cooling systems running smoothly. It's not just about fixing a broken part when it's too late. Full-scope service includes regular maintenance to prevent problems, repairs for unexpected breakdowns, and of course, emergency response for those urgent situations. Many local homeowners schedule seasonal tune-ups—a spring check for the AC before the summer heat and a fall inspection for the furnace before winter. This proactive approach is smart, especially with our climate. But when something goes wrong, same-day service or a 24/7 emergency call can be a real lifesaver.

What Qualifies as a Real HVAC Emergency?

Knowing when to panic can actually keep you calm. An HVAC emergency is any situation that puts your safety, health, or property at immediate risk. In Norcross, we consider these true emergencies:

  • Total Loss of Heat in Freezing Weather: If your furnace quits during a winter cold snap, especially with kids or elderly family members at home, that's an emergency.
  • Complete AC Failure During a Heatwave: When temperatures soar into the 90s and your AC blows warm air, the risk of heat exhaustion becomes real.
  • Gas Smells or Suspected Carbon Monoxide: If you smell rotten eggs (the scent added to natural gas) or your CO alarm is beeping, evacuate and call for help immediately.
  • Electrical Burning Smells or Smoke: Any burning odor from your furnace, air handler, or thermostat could indicate a dangerous electrical fault.
  • Major Water Leaks from the AC System: If your indoor AC unit is dripping or pooling water, it can cause significant damage to floors, walls, and ceilings.

These are safety-first situations that require urgent professional attention.

How Norcross Climate and Homes Challenge HVAC Systems

Our local weather here in Gwinnett County is tough on HVAC equipment. The high summer humidity makes AC units work overtime, leading to frozen coils and stressed compressors. Our occasional winter cold snaps push furnaces and heat pumps to their limits. Pollen in the spring and fall can clog filters and coils, reducing efficiency. Norcross homes range from historic houses in Old Town with older gas furnaces to newer subdivisions in the Peachtree Corners area with high-efficiency heat pumps. We see everything from central AC systems paired with gas furnaces to ductless mini-splits in condos and townhomes. Understanding your specific system is key to proper service.

Common HVAC Problems We See in Norcross Neighborhoods

As local technicians, we see certain issues again and again across Norcross, from Beaver Ruin to Peachtree Station. During the sweltering summers, calls pour in for AC units that aren't cooling. Often, it's a dirty air filter or a clogged condensate line—the drain that removes water. When that line clogs, water can leak right into your home, damaging drywall. In the winter, furnaces that won't ignite are common. One homeowner in the Brookhaven Park area called us on a chilly Sunday because their furnace kept clicking but wouldn't start. It turned out to be a faulty flame sensor, a quick but crucial repair. Another common issue is failing capacitors, which are like the starters for your AC's motor. When they go bad, your outside unit just hums but won't turn on.

Emergency HVAC, Same-Day Service, or Routine Appointment?

Not every problem needs a 3 a.m. phone call. Here's a simple guide:

  • Call for Emergency HVAC Service Now: For the safety-critical issues listed above—no heat in freezing temps, gas smells, CO alarms, burning smells, or major leaks.
  • Schedule Same-Day HVAC Service: For urgent but not life-threatening issues, like your AC blowing slightly warm air on a hot day, a strange noise that just started, or a thermostat that's completely dead. We can often get to you within hours.
  • Book a Routine HVAC Service Appointment: For maintenance, seasonal tune-ups, minor noises that have been ongoing, or a gradual decrease in cooling or heating performance. This is the most cost-effective path.

Understanding this difference helps you get the right help at the right time.

What Does HVAC Service Cost in Norcross, GA?

We believe in transparency. Costs depend on the service type, time, and parts needed. Here’s a breakdown:

  • Diagnostic Fee: Most HVAC companies, including ours, charge a standard fee to diagnose the problem. This covers the technician's time and expertise to pinpoint the issue. Locally, this typically ranges from $75 to $125.
  • Emergency Call-Out Fee: For after-hours, weekend, or holiday service, an additional emergency dispatch fee applies. This compensates for the urgent response. In the Norcross area, this fee is often between $100 and $200 on top of the diagnostic fee.
  • Labor & Parts: After diagnosis, you'll be quoted for the repair labor and any necessary parts. Labor rates vary, but after-hours labor is often 1.5 to 2 times the standard rate. Standard hourly labor in Norcross can range from $85 to $150 per hour.

Example Scenario: A capacitor replacement on a Saturday afternoon in July. Cost might include: Emergency Call-Out Fee ($150) + Diagnostic Fee ($89) + Part ($50) + 1 Hour of After-Hours Labor ($180). Total estimated range: $469.

Another Example: A routine Tuesday morning tune-up for your AC. This would likely be a flat-rate service, often between $100 and $200, with no emergency fees.

Signs You Need Immediate HVAC Service

  • No heat when outdoor temps are below freezing.
  • Your carbon monoxide alarm is sounding.
  • You smell a strong gas odor near the furnace.
  • You see smoke or smell burning from HVAC equipment.
  • Water is actively pooling from your indoor AC unit.
  • There are loud banging, popping, or electrical buzzing noises.
  • Your AC has completely failed during a period of dangerous heat.

What to Do While Waiting for Help: A Safety Checklist

  • If you smell gas: evacuate everyone from the home immediately, call your gas utility from outside, and then call for emergency HVAC service.
  • If the CO alarm sounds: get fresh air immediately and call for help.
  • If safe to do so, shut off the HVAC system at the thermostat or the circuit breaker.
  • Keep away from any electrical components that are sparking or smoking.
  • Move children, elderly family members, or anyone with health concerns to a safe, temperate location if possible.
  • Most importantly: Never attempt to repair gas lines, electrical issues, or refrigerant problems yourself.

Local Codes and Why Professional Service Matters

In Norcross and across Georgia, HVAC work must comply with specific codes. Furnace venting must be correct to prevent carbon monoxide poisoning. Handling refrigerant requires an EPA Section 608 certification—it's illegal and unsafe for anyone without this license. Major installations like a new furnace or AC often require a permit from Gwinnett County. Using a licensed, insured HVAC service provider ensures the work is done safely, correctly, and up to code, protecting your home and your family.

What to Expect When You Call for Service

When you call for emergency HVAC service in Norcross, a dispatcher will gather key details to understand the urgency and prepare the technician. Depending on the time of day, traffic on I-85 or Peachtree Industrial Boulevard, and call volume, a technician is typically dispatched within 60 to 180 minutes. They'll call ahead with an estimated arrival time. Once on site, they'll diagnose the problem, explain it clearly, provide a transparent quote, and get your approval before starting any repair.
